Mechanical Ventilation - Comparing Volume Control to Pressure Control + Scalars | Clinical Medicine
Pressure control and volume control are the most common two modes for mechanical ventilation in both children and adults. Understanding these two modes is critical for critically ill patients. In this video we compare these two modes side-by-side discussing their similarities and differences. We use trigger, target, and cycling as a way to better understand them and compare their pressure, flow, and volume scalars to gain a fuller understanding.
